Madam Speaker, I rise in support of this rule and in support of the underlying legislation. House Resolution 756 provides for consideration of H.R. 4394, the Energy and Water Development and Related Agencies Appropriations Act of 2024, under a structured rule, with 1 hour of debate equally divided and controlled by the chair and ranking minority member of the Committee on Appropriations or their respective designees and provides one motion to recommit. The rule makes in order 60 amendments. Further, the rule provides for consideration of H.R. 4364, the Legislative Branch Appropriations Act, 2024, under a closed rule, with 1 hour of debate equally divided and controlled by the chair and ranking minority member of the Committee on Appropriations or their respective designees and provides for one motion to recommit.
